11 Ludgate Close is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Water Orton, Birmingham, Birmingham (B46 1RP). It has a recorded floor area of 63 m² (around 678 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(July 2019) shows an F (score 31),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would lift it to D (score 67),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. At 63 m² this is the 8th smallest of 10 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 58–65 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to C,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(31 versus a best of 70).
Sale prices here have outpaced Birmingham HPI: 3.3%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£153,000 is 24.4% above the 2020 sale price.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 89% of similar EPCs). Sold January 2020 for £123,000.
